About this position
Postdoctoral vacancy at the University of Cambridge in the Cavendish Laboratory, Department of Physics, working with Louise Hirst.
The project focuses on the development of single-photon avalanche diodes for LiDAR applications, with support from the Quantum Enabled Position, Navigation and Timing hub. This is a research-intensive opportunity for candidates with interests in Physics, Electrical Engineering, Photonics, optoelectronics, and related semiconductor device development.
